surrealdb / revision
A Rust library for revision-tolerant serialisation and deserialisation, with support for schema evolution over time
☆29Updated 2 months ago
Alternatives and similar repositories for revision:
Users that are interested in revision are comparing it to the libraries listed below
- Deserialize (potentially nested) environment variables into your custom structs☆59Updated last year
- ☆65Updated 10 months ago
- A generic abstraction of paginated APIs☆60Updated last year
- Open a scope and then freeze it in time for future access.☆107Updated 8 months ago
- Reports when tokio runtime threads are blocking☆64Updated 8 months ago
- ☆147Updated this week
- Remoc 🦑 — Remote multiplexed objects, channels and RPC for Rust☆191Updated last month
- Graceful shutdown util for Rust projects using the Tokio Async runtime.☆135Updated 7 months ago
- A Platform-less, Runtime-less Actor Computing Model☆122Updated last year
- Typed any map for rust☆66Updated 4 months ago
- A thread pool for running multiple tasks on a configurable group of threads.☆50Updated last year
- ☆43Updated last month
- A token-based rate limiter based on the leaky bucket algorithm.☆108Updated 3 weeks ago
- Progress reporting abstraction for Rust☆64Updated 9 months ago
- ☆62Updated last week
- Draw chart with svg for leptos☆61Updated last year
- A versatile and developer-friendly trait mocking library☆74Updated 3 weeks ago
- Trait implementation generator macro☆28Updated this week
- It executes futures☆58Updated 2 years ago
- Streaming JSON reader and writer written in Rust☆72Updated this week
- Serde partial serialization made easy☆42Updated 2 years ago
- Zero-cost type for stack without complicated type or Box☆45Updated 3 weeks ago
- Async, lock-free synchronization primitives for task wakeup☆44Updated 7 months ago
- A utility crate to log errors without losing key information along the way.☆30Updated 3 months ago
- Port of bbolt in Rust☆65Updated 7 months ago
- Provides json/csv/protobuf/arrow streaming support for axum☆74Updated 3 weeks ago
- Compile-time regular expressions, the right way.☆77Updated 2 months ago
- Static analysis tool for Rust library authors to set and verify which types from other libraries are allowed to be exposed in their publi…☆54Updated this week
- Deserialization library with focus on error handling☆48Updated 2 months ago
- Simple async codec for rkyv. Reuses streaming buffer for maximum speed!☆33Updated last year